The HBDTECH PV550 is a solar pump inverter (solar VFD) built exclusively for photovoltaic water pumping. It converts DC power from solar panels into variable-frequency AC to drive a water pump directly — with MPPT, automatic PV/AC switching, water-level detection and dry-run protection. It is intended for three off-grid water scenarios: agricultural irrigation, livestock drinking water, and village / community water supply.
Key features
| Item | PV550 spec / capability |
|---|---|
| Motor control | Sensorless vector control; speed accuracy ~±1 rpm at 100% torque; torque response <20 ms |
| Starting torque | 150% starting torque at 0.3 Hz (sensorless vector control) |
| Input | Solar PV DC input; AC grid / generator backup with automatic switching |
| MPPT | Accurate, fast maximum-power-point tracking; manual set or auto tracking |
| Water management | Water-level detection (digital / analog); dry-run and light-load protection, auto dormancy |
| Communication | RS485 / Modbus |
| Protection | Over-voltage, over-current, under-voltage, overload and other complete protections |
| Display | Live PV power, PV DC current and operating parameters |
| Operating mode | Automatic all-day or manual control; sunrise/sunset scheduling ("sunrise income") |
| Pump compatibility | 3-phase asynchronous induction motors (submersible & surface), sized by motor power |

PV550 vs a general-purpose VFD
| Item | PV550 solar pump inverter | General VFD (e.g. 550 series) |
|---|---|---|
| Input | Solar DC + AC backup, auto switch | AC grid input |
| MPPT | Built-in, tracks PV max power | None |
| Water level / dry-run | Built-in detection & dry-run protection | None (external only) |
| Typical use | Off-grid solar pumping (irrigation / drinking / village) | General motor speed control, automation |
FAQ
Q1: Can the PV550 run without grid power?
Yes. The PV550 runs primarily on solar DC input in fully off-grid mode; grid or generator is only AC backup and switches in automatically on outage.
Q2: Does the PV550 work with any water pump?
It drives 3-phase asynchronous induction motors (submersible or surface). Select the PV550 model by the connected pump motor power.
Q3: How does it prevent dry running?
Water-level detection (digital or analog input) judges the level; combined with dry-run protection and light-load auto dormancy, it stops the pump when the level is too low.
Q4: Can the PV550 be used as a general industrial VFD?
No. The PV550 is solar-pump dedicated. For general speed control / automation, use the HBDTECH 550 series general VFD.
Q5: What communication is supported?
RS485 / Modbus, for connecting to a supervisory system or HMI to read operating parameters.
